A game development studio is seeking an Associate Sound Designer who will work collaboratively to design and create audio assets for an exciting project. The ideal candidate should have experience in audio design for games, familiarity with Unreal Engine 4/5, and knowledge of audio middleware like Audiokinetic Wwise.
This fully remote position offers excellent benefits, including generous PTO and health allowances. Join a passionate, creative team dedicated to creating an impactful gaming experience.

How to prepare for a job interview at Escape Velocity Entertainment
✨Know Your Audio Tools
Make sure you’re well-versed in Unreal Engine 4/5 and audio middleware like Audiokinetic Wwise. Brush up on your technical skills and be ready to discuss how you've used these tools in past projects. This will show that you’re not just familiar with the software, but that you can leverage it effectively.
✨Showcase Your Collaboration Skills
Since this role involves working closely with a team, prepare examples of how you’ve successfully collaborated on audio design projects. Think about specific challenges you faced and how you overcame them together. This will highlight your ability to work in a creative environment.
✨Prepare Your Portfolio
Have a well-organised portfolio ready that showcases your best audio assets. Include a variety of work that demonstrates your range and creativity. Be prepared to discuss the thought process behind each piece and how it contributes to the gaming experience.
✨Research the Studio's Projects
Take some time to research the game development studio and their previous projects. Understanding their style and the types of games they create will help you tailor your responses and show genuine interest in their work. It’s a great way to connect your skills to their needs.
